I stared down at the letter in front of me, blurry through the tears in my eyes. It had been waiting for me on the kitchen table when Iâd returned home from Christmas shopping. I suspected Callum of leaving it at first, but I hadnât seen him the past three days, and I didnât think Callum would risk getting caught when he was so obviously avoiding me.
Callum, who had apologized andâwhat?âsaid he was gay? I still wasnât sure. And I was more confused than ever.
Now this. Now Astrid, laying bare my faults. I could see the urn resting on the mantle from where I sat at the scarred wooden kitchen table. In the spring, when the flowers were in bloom, I planned to have a memorial service and release her ashes at the top of the hill where the house, the church, and the pond were all visible. It had been Astridâs favorite spot. But for now, she rested in Hummingbird House, the home of her heart.
âI know you just want me to be happy, but I donât know if I remember how without you here to tell me.â Once again, tears welled behind my eyes. Somewhere along the way, Iâd forgotten how to live. Since Astrid had been diagnosed, my happiness revolved around her good days. I didnât remember what it was like to live for myself. And I felt selfish even wanting to do so.
But maybe that life wasnât cut out for me. The life of happiness. Itâs not that I didnât want it. I simply didnât know if I could handle it. For as long as I could remember, Iâd stood in my own way and sabotaged (albeit subconsciouslyâI thought) every relationship Iâd ever had. Heavily, I sat back with a huff. And it all started with Callum. The one guy who was so unattainable I couldnât help myself, couldnât stop myself from proving what Iâd always knownâthat I wasnât worth it. Wasnât worth the time. Wasnât worth the fight. Wasnât worth the effort.
Iâd always known it. Hell, my mother had drilled it into my head for as long as I could remember. But then there was Callum. And he was nice to me and funny, and I had only wanted to hope, to feel a fraction of the happiness and belonging Callum exuded, so Iâd done it. Iâd kissed him when our guards were down, and for the briefest of moments, Iâd basked in the feeling of being wanted. Until I wasnât, and it was all over, and I knew, as Iâd always known, that Iâd never be good enough, never be special or lovable enough for that kind of love.
The only place I belonged, had ever belonged, was with Astrid. No one in my life had ever loved me, not really. No one but Astrid. So I dove into the role of caretaker and gave everything to her that she had given to me. Sheâd taken me when I had nowhere else to go.
